Job Responsibilities The Site Engineer will be responsible for the supervision, execution, quality control, measurement, and coordination of road construction activities at the project site.
1. Road Construction & Site Execution

- Supervise day-to-day construction activities for flexible and rigid pavement roads.
- Ensure execution of works as per approved drawings, specifications, BOQ, method statements, and applicable standards.
- Supervise earthwork, embankment, subgrade preparation, excavation, filling, compaction, and formation works.
- Supervise construction of Granular Sub-Base (GSB), Wet Mix Macadam (WMM), Dense Bituminous Macadam (DBM), Bituminous Concrete (BC) and other bituminous layers.
- Supervise PCC/RCC pavement, DLC, PQC, reinforcement, dowel bars, tie bars, joints, curing, and related rigid pavement works.
- Ensure proper levels, line, grade, camber, cross-fall, thickness, and compaction of pavement layers.
- Coordinate with surveyors for setting out and checking levels and alignment.

1. Quality Control

- Ensure construction activities comply with approved specifications and relevant MoRTH, IRC and IS standards, as applicable.
- Coordinate with the laboratory for field and material testing.
- Monitor testing of soil, aggregates, concrete, bituminous materials, and pavement layers.
- Ensure proper sampling, testing, documentation, and maintenance of quality records.
- Identify and rectify defective or non-conforming work.

1. Quantity & Measurement

- Take measurements of completed works and maintain accurate measurement records.
- Prepare and verify Measurement Books (MB), quantity calculations, and work statements.
- Monitor quantities executed against BOQ and identify variations.
- Assist in preparation of RA bills and supporting documents.




- Maintain daily progress reports and site records.
